Agnes-3.0-Flash beats Qwen on AA index, but nobody knows which model was tested
Aggressive_Aspect436 · reddit · 2026-09-13
A Reddit user dug into Agnes-3.0-Flash, a 33B model claiming to beat Qwen3.8 27B on the ArtificialAnalysis intelligence index, and found inconsistencies: the HF listing is marked "Preview" and explicitly states it is not the model AA evaluated; AA lists it as proprietary yet rates it above Qwen on "Openness"; and AA doesn't disclose the evaluated model's parameter count, so the two may share nothing architecturally. The community remains skeptical about the lab's intentions.
